1) Indian-American Vivek Murthy took charge as U.S. Surgeon-General:
--> Indian-American Vivek Murthy was sworn-in as the U.S. Surgeon-General by Vice-President Joe Biden at a ceremony on 23 April 2015, becoming the youngest-ever in-charge of the country’s public health.
--> Dr. Murthy, who took the oath on the Gita, is now the highest ranking Indian-American in the Obama administration.
--> Dr. Murthy is the country’s 19th Surgeon General.

3) Calbuco volcano erupted in Chile for the first time in 42 years:
--> The Calbuco volcano has erupted for the first time in more than 42 years, billowing a huge ash cloud over a sparsely populated, mountainous area in southern Chile.
--> Calbuco last erupted in 1972 and is considered one of the top three most potentially dangerous among Chile’s 90 active volcanos.

5) India and France began 10-Day Naval exercise named 'Varuna':
--> India and France on 23 April 2015 began 10-day naval exercise 'Varuna' that will see 12 Rafale fighter jets in action off the Goa coast along with a host of naval assets of both countries.
--> The 14th edition of 'Varuna' started with the arrival of four French naval ships at Goa including aircraft carrier Charles de Gaulle, two destroyers Chevalier Paul and Jean de Vienne, replenishment tanker Meuse and a maritime patrol aircraft Atlantique 2.

6) World Book and Copyright Day observed:
--> United Nations (UN) observed World Book and Copyright Day across the world on 23 April 2015.
--> The day is an opportunity to recognise the power of books to change our lives for the better and to support books and those who produce them.
--> For the year 2015, UNESCO designated Incheon, South Korea as the World Book Capital 2015 in recognition of its programme to promote reading among people and underprivileged sections of the population.
--> In 1995, UNESCO decided that the World Book and Copyright Day would be celebrated on 23 April, as the date is also the anniversary of the death of William Shakespeare and Inca Garcilaso de la Vega.

7) Rajiv Ranjan Verma appointed DG, RPF:
--> Senior IPS officer Rajiv Ranjan Verma was on 22 April 2015 appointed as Director General of Railway Protection Force (RPF).
--> Verma, a 1978 batch IPS officer of Bihar cadre, is presently posted as Director General of National Crime Records Bureau (NCRB).

--> He has been appointed for a period upto the date of his superannuation, i.E. February 29, 2016, an order issued by Department of Personnel and Training (DoPT) said.
